Unable to play any Live TV channels since upgrading to the latest Android TV version

Since updating my Android TV version to the latest and recently released build, I am now unable to watch any Live TV channels. No matter what I select or how I select it, I receive the message “An error occurred while attempting to play this video. Please try restarting both the Plex Media Server and this app”.

Following the instruction does not resolve the problem and I am seeing this on both my Nvidia Shield Pro 2019 and a 2019 Phillips TV. This problem was not present (for me) in the previous version and rolling back does restore access (though losing the nice new features). The other thing that ‘fixes’ it is disabling the new player which is not a preferred solution if it can be avoided.

If anyone has an alternative solution then great, otherwise highlighting to the Dev’s that the new version / TV features may have introduced problems for some.

Server Version#: 1.18.9.2571
Player Version#: 7.30.0.16390

I had this same problem on my Shield 2017. Disabling the new media player option in the Plex client software fixed it for me until Plex support fixes this obvious bug following advice in this thread:

Can you both please provide some client and server logs after replicating the issue?

That way we can try and fix these issues before there is no longer an option to disable the new player. :slight_smile:

Attached is a log from a Live TV program being recorded I was attempting to watch this morning. Starting at about line 13168 you will see errors when I was attempting to play the program from the beginning.

This set of error messages appear to repeat many times:

Mar 27, 2020 08:00:04.408 [12560] ERROR - [Transcoder] [h264 @ 0x22d352d500] non-existing SPS 0 referenced in buffering period
Mar 27, 2020 08:00:04.409 [5510] ERROR - [Transcoder] [h264 @ 0x22d352d500] SPS unavailable in decode_picture_timing
Mar 27, 2020 08:00:04.410 [6653] ERROR - [Transcoder] [h264 @ 0x22d352d500] non-existing PPS 0 referenced
Mar 27, 2020 08:00:04.412 [6652] ERROR - [Transcoder] [h264 @ 0x22d352d500] non-existing SPS 0 referenced in buffering period
Mar 27, 2020 08:00:04.414 [14967] ERROR - [Transcoder] [h264 @ 0x22d352d500] SPS unavailable in decode_picture_timing
Mar 27, 2020 08:00:04.419 [12552] ERROR - [Transcoder] [h264 @ 0x22d352d500] non-existing PPS 0 referenced
Mar 27, 2020 08:00:04.420 [12560] ERROR - [Transcoder] [h264 @ 0x22d352d500] decode_slice_header error
Mar 27, 2020 08:00:04.421 [5510] ERROR - [Transcoder] [h264 @ 0x22d352d500] no frame!

Plex Media Server.log (5.2 MB)

Hi @DaveBinM

Please find attached some server and client logs files to supplement my original post. These logs were generated as a result of doing as little as possible other than browsing to the TV guide, selecting a live channel to watch and waiting about 5 seconds for the error to appear.

The client was a Shield 2019 pro.

Please let me know if this was not what you were expecting me to do.

Thanks James

Android TV Client Log Files.txt (1.2 MB)
Plex Media Server Logs_2020-03-27_19-50-24.zip (4.5 MB)

Hi,
Same problem here with a Windows server serving a Shield TV 2017 on plex. Everything is update…
Is it possible to download an older server version (just one week away) to try to solve this problem? It’s maybe this…

Regards,
Patrick

Note I was able to duplicate this problem on my Pixel 3XL Plex client app also. So speculating some sort of server issue? I’m running 1.18.9.2571.

I also found this issue: Unable to play videos after Version 1.18.9.2571 update

@Jibidibo You may want to connect with your team member @ChuckPa

Thanks, I’ve passed these along to our development team. :plexheart:

So we had a look at these, and it appears to be related to DNS rebinding, which we should have a fix for in v7.31 (which should be in beta soon). :plexheart:

@DaveBinM Thank you for passing on the logs and for following up with some positive information about a potential fix. I’ll keep out eye for the upcoming beta(s) and will advise (either way) whether it fixes the problem for me.

Thanks for your patience and the extra data you’ve given us! :plexheart:

Hi @DaveBinM,

I can confirm that the error that I was seeing when attempting to watch live TV within the Android TV Plex app has been resolved within the newly released 7.31.x beta.

Thank you for your help in getting this fixed.

1 Like

No worries! Thank you for your patience! :plexheart:

Hi @DaveBinM

Just to let you know that the newest version of the beta (7.31.0.16605) has reintroduced the error with live TV that the previous beta version had resolved.

Please let me know if you need any logs on the newest version of both server and app to help troubleshoot.

Yeah, some new logs would be great! Thank you! :plexheart:

Hi @DaveBinM,

Please find attached the new logs that you requested. Again, Plex should only need to look at the last 5 minutes or so of the logs for items of interest.

Steps within those last 5mins to create these logs

  1. Upgrade to newest version of Android TV Beta
  2. Restart Plex Server
  3. Turn on network logging on Android App
  4. Tune to DVR channel
  5. Receive error
  6. Collect Logs

Let me know if you need anything else.

Android TV Client Logs.txt (851.9 KB)
Plex Media Server Logs_2020-04-06_14-31-44.zip (4.2 MB)

Hi @DaveBinM

Not to chase a response to these logs as I know that you are busy, but I would be keen to know your thoughts given something that I have found. Essentially, I have found that all of the problems that I have with the use of the new player for both Live TV and media in my existing library disappear when I set ‘Secure Connections’ to disabled in the network settings on the server. I won’t attempt to guess why this would be the case but as a Plex server owner who shares no content outside of the home and rarely, if ever, watches anything remotely, how big an issue would you consider disabling secure connections in my use case?

Thanks
James

Well, I’d highly recommend having it always set to required, or at least preferred. Do you use your own custom domain or certificate or anything with your server?

I don’t use my own domain, certificates, but neither does my router provide the option to prevent DNS rebinding or add a dnsmasq string.

Seems that I am stuck between choosing security or functionality for the time being…

Similar issue, though Roku and web browser player seem to work fine, only SONY Android TV has a problem, same behaviour, Channel tries to load the Error " An error occured while attempting to play this video. Please try restarting both the Plex Media Server and this app.

PlexmediaServer version 1.19.2.2711
AndroidTV App Version 7.31.0.16802

Logs from the server show:
with transcoding
Apr 29, 2020 01:03:41.852 [0x7fd2bdff3700] Error — Unable to find title for item of type 5
Apr 29, 2020 01:03:41.854 [0x7fd2bdff3700] Error — Unable to find title for item of type 5
Apr 29, 2020 01:03:42.430 [0x7fd33ffff700] Error — [Transcoder] [mpeg2video @ 0xf898c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:03:42.471 [0x7fd33f7fe700] Error — [Transcoder] [mpeg2video @ 0xf898c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:03:42.481 [0x7fd34fd29700] Error — [Transcoder] [mpeg2video @ 0xf898c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:03:42.499 [0x7fd33ffff700] Error — [Transcoder] [mpeg2video @ 0xf898c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:03:42.501 [0x7fd33f7fe700] Error — [Transcoder] [mpeg2video @ 0xf898c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:03:42.501 [0x7fd34fd29700] Error — [Transcoder] [mpeg2video @ 0xf898c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:03:42.511 [0x7fd33ffff700] Error — [Transcoder] [mpeg2video @ 0xf898c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:03:42.512 [0x7fd33f7fe700] Error — [Transcoder] [mpeg2video @ 0xf898c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:03:42.628 [0x7fd34fd29700] Error — [Transcoder] [mpeg2video @ 0xf898c0] Invalid frame dimensions 0x0.

Without Trancoding
Apr 29, 2020 01:05:12.397 [0x7fd2bbfef700] Error — Unable to find title for item of type 5
Apr 29, 2020 01:05:12.398 [0x7fd2bbfef700] Error — Unable to find title for item of type 5
Apr 29, 2020 01:05:13.022 [0x7fd30d7fa700] Error — [Transcoder] [mpeg2video @ 0xf2f8c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:05:13.137 [0x7fd30d7fa700] Error — [Transcoder] [mpeg2video @ 0xf2f8c0] Invalid frame dimensions 0x0.
Apr 29, 2020 01:05:17.819 [0x7fd33d7fa700] Warning — SLOW QUERY: It took 360.000000 ms to retrieve 0 items.